Apache(137)

137follower
@iwasaki さんのアバター 53views

Apacheのアクセスログでhtmlページヘのアクセスだけを見る

Apacheのアクセスログで画像やcssのログを見たくない時には以下のようにしてフィルタリングを行います。 tail -f /var/log/httpd/access_log | grep -v 'css' | grep -v 'js'... 2015年1月20日
alkoshikawa さんのアバター 175views

PaperLiBotを遮断する

静的ページなら大したことないですが、 PHPなどのページでBOTによるアクセスがくると止まるのでアクセスの制限をおこないます。 .htaccessに以下を記述 BrowserMatchNoCase PaperLiBot bad_bot ... 2015年1月7日
otaguro さんのアバター 169views

テスト用に任意のHTTPレスポンスを返すページをXAMPPを使って用意する方法

1. https://www.apachefriends.org/jp/index.html からXAMPPをダウンロードしてインストールする。 2. C:\xampp\htdocsに空のファイル.htaccessを配置する。 3.... 2014年12月1日
高瀬 裕介 さんのアバター 215views

hostsファイルの書き換えが必要なアクセスをcurlで実現する

検証環境での動作確認などでhostsファイルを書き換えてサイト表示の確認が必要な場合、curlで同様のことを実現するためには-HオプションでHostヘッダを追加します。 curl -v http://127.0.0.1/ -H 'Host... 2014年11月26日
alkoshikawa さんのアバター 437views

apacheのビルドオプションを調べる

apachectl -V こんなのが出る、 MPMがどのモードで動いているのか調べるにもこのコマンドを使う。(prefork, worker, event) Server version: Apache/2.2.9 (Unix) Se... 2014年10月10日
@iwasaki さんのアバター 12,795views

Apacheがpreforkで動いているかworkerで動いているかを確認する方法

httpd.confには以下のようにMaxClientを設定する箇所があります。 # prefork MPM # StartServers: number of server processes to start # MinSpareSe... 2014年9月12日
@iwasaki さんのアバター 1,637views

Apacheの子プロセスあたりの平均メモリ使用量を調べる

Apacheの子プロセスの平均的なメモリ使用量を一発で調べる方法です。 ただしこれは時間帯とかそのタイミングでの特徴的なアクセスが有った場合にはもちろん揺らぎます。 # ps aux | grep [h]ttpd | grep [a]pa... 2014年9月12日
@iwasaki さんのアバター 2,413views

ApacheでProxyしてるところに対してBasic認証を付ける

まずはモジュールの読み込み LoadModule proxy_module modules/mod_proxy.so LoadModule proxy_http_module modules/mod_proxy_http.so Bas... 2014年9月2日
@iwasaki さんのアバター 366views

htaccessにリダイレクトの設定を書く

<IfModule mod_rewrite.c> RewriteEngine On RewriteCond %{REQUEST_URI} ^form.php RewriteCond %{SER... 2014年8月26日
@iwasaki さんのアバター 255views

Apacheで特定のファイルだけhttpsへの転送を外す

hoge.phpだけHTTPSへの転送を外す方法です。 <IfModule mod_rewrite.c> RewriteEngine On RewriteCond %{REQUEST_URI} !^/h... 2014年8月25日
@iwasaki さんのアバター 2,082views

Apacheで特定のファイルだけBasic認証を外す

特定のファイル hoge.phpだけBasic認証を外す方法です。 <Directory "/var/www/html"> Order deny,allow Allow from all AuthUse... 2014年8月25日
高瀬 裕介 さんのアバター 314views

Xamppを使って既存のApacheとは別にPHP4専用のAPサーバーをたてる

cd /usr/local/src wget http://downloads.sourceforge.net/project/xampp/XAMPP%20Linux/1.4.14/xampp-linux-1.4.14.tar.gz ta... 2014年7月31日
alkoshikawa さんのアバター 302views

httpdのプロセス数を制限する

アプリケーションの中にはhttpdの1プロセス辺り100MB近く使い、 1分ぐらい生き残るモヒカン系アプリケーションがあります。 そんなアプリケーションがデフォルト値限界までプロセスを生成したらどうなるかというと、 Swapが発生して直にサ... 2014年7月28日
高瀬 裕介 さんのアバター 216views

Apacheで設定されているバーチャルホスト一覧を表示するコマンド

apachectl -S ... 2014年7月25日
y-ozaki さんのアバター 443views

ログ出力の際のレイアウトの設定

logを出力する際のレイアウトはプロパティファイルで設定ができます。 aipoのログの設定以下のようになっています。 log4j.appender.cayenne = org.apache.log4j.RollingFileAppend... 2014年7月24日
alkoshikawa さんのアバター 229views

アクセスログにx-forwared-forと処理時間を追加する

通常combinedという形式でアクセスログが出てきますが、アクセスログ解析の関係上ここはいじらずにx-forwared-forと処理時間を追加します。 Apache LogFormat "%h %l %u %t \"... 2014年7月18日
高瀬 裕介 さんのアバター 437views

Apacheのアクセスログからアクセスの多いユーザーエージェントを探す

cat /var/log/httpd/access_log | cut -f6 -d'"' | uniq -c | sort -r | more ... 2014年7月16日
alkoshikawa さんのアバター 794views

ZabbixAgent設定内容

ZabbixAgent設定内容 SourceIP 複数のIPアドレスを持つときに、使用したいネットワークを指定できる http://d.hatena.ne.jp/ike-dai/20101107/1289135649 EnableR... 2014年7月10日
alkoshikawa さんのアバター 868views

Apache BenchでUAを指定する方法

ab -n 100 -c 10 -H 'User-Agent: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/535.7 (KHTML, like Gecko) Chrome/16.... 2014年7月8日
Tetsuro  Aoki さんのアバター 1,876views

apache benchでcookieを指定する方法

abコマンド(apache bench)で負荷テストを行うとき、ログインした状態でテストを行うなどの理由でcookieを指定したい場合は以下のようにします。 ab -n 1 -c 1 -C "key1=abcdedf; key2... 2014年7月1日